Specificity

NB100-64612 recognizes an antigen expressed by most endothelial cells in the pig. Expression is strongest upon intestinal endothelial cells, and staining is also seen upon endothelial cells in the lung, colon, trachea, thymus, lymph nodes, kidney and skin. In blood vessels MIL11 stains venous endothelial cells but not arterial endothelial cells.

Background: Endothelial Cells

The endothelium is the layer of thin specialized epithelium, comprising a simple squamous layer of cells that line the interior surface of blood vessels, forming an interface between circulating blood in the lumen and the rest of the vessel wall (simple squamous epithelium). Endothelial cells line the entire circulatory system, from the heart to the smallest capillary. Endothelial cells are involved in many aspects of vascular biology, such as vasoconstriction and vasodilation, and hence the control of blood pressure; blood clotting (thrombosis & fibrinolysis); atherosclerosis; formation of new blood vessels (angiogenesis) and inflammation and swelling (oedema). Endothelial cells also control the passage of materials, and the transit of white blood cells, into and out of the bloodstream.
